This weekend, the quickest and most powerful drag cars, trucks and SUVs packing a Hemi V8 will roll into No Problem Raceway in New Orleans for the first event of the 2020 Modern Street Hemi Shootout series schedule.


The opening event of the 2020 MSHS season is sponsored by Legmaker Intakes and it is the first of nine that will be held by the all-Hemi racing series. As has been the case in past years, Allpar will share race results as the season continues, but leading up to the first event of the season, we wanted to touch on the key changes for the New Year while tying up some loose ends from 2019.

2020 Modern Street Hemi Shootout Schedule:
March 6-7 No Problem Raceway, LA
April 17-19 Rockingham, NC
May 29-31 Maryland International Raceway, MD
June 19-20 Kentucky Dragway, KY
Aug 13-15 Detroit, MI (dream cruise)
Sep 10-12 Virginia Motorsports Park, VA
Oct 2-3 Houston, TX (Lone Star Mopar Fest)
Nov 6-7 Atco Dragway, NJ (season finale)
Nov 8 Cecil County Dragway, MD (non points)

2020 Classes:
HEMI Outlaw (1/8th mile heads up)
Super Pro 8.50 index
Heavyweight (1/4 mile heads up)
Hellcat 10.00 index
Modified 10.50 index
Super Stock 11.50 index
Street 12.50 index
Bracket (pro dial)
Legion of Demons (1/4 mile heads up)
Rookie (pro dial)
King of the Hill (pro dial run off of class winners)

The two new classes for 2020 are HEMI Outlaw and Heavyweight.

VanHorn Challenger

HEMI Outlaw is, as VanHorn puts it “very outlaw”. A Gen3 Hemi engine is required and naturally aspirated cars have no minimum weight requirement. Single power-adder cars must weigh 3,300lbs with the driver while dual power-adder cars have to weigh at least 3,500lbs.


As for the Heavyweight class, it is essentially grudge racing with some key rules. This is a ¼-mile, heads-up, no time class. Single power-adder cars must weigh at least 4,400lbs and dual power-adder cars must weigh at least 4,600lbs. Naturally aspirated cars only have to weigh 3,000lbs, so they aren’t quite as heavy as the boosted cars, but we are likely to see some that are just as quick.
